1. Suitable for the 2 pole stator’s winding, automatic feeding, compaction, loading clamp die, winding, clamping and cutting wires.
2. Cast iron rack, precision stable, absorbing vibrations, even at high speed winding the vibrations are also very small.
3. Clamp part adopts down positioning way, stable positioning, intensify and reliable.
4. Wire clamping and cutting parts are compact structure, wire clamping and cutting complete once.
5. Stroke and pivot angle are adjustable within a certain range (mechanical adjustment), in order to adapt different stators’ requirement.
6. Quick change of different type mold.
7. All aluminum alloy protection
8. PLC control, fault display

- Q: What is the classification of ac motor?
- According to the number of different ac power, and can be divided into two major categories of single-phase and three-phase ac motor, is currently the most widely used three-phase asynchronous motor, this is because the three-phase asynchronous motor has simple structure, low cost, strong and durable, convenient in operation and maintenance, etc. A single phase asynchronous motor is widely used in situations where there is no three-phase power supply and some small motors

- Q: What is the electrical Angle in the motor? What does it have to do with mechanical angles
- For polar motor, the stator inner circle of power Angle and the mechanical Angle is equal to 360 °; And p on the pole motor, the stator inner circle electric all Angle is 360 ° p, but still mechanical Angle is 360 °. So there is a relationship between the two: Electrical Angle = mechanical Angle times logarithmic
